Performance Characteristics
Pressure-drop
The pressure-drop in a filter system is the pressure difference before and after the filter system.
Pressure-drop occurs due to transfer valves, pipe bends, filter media selection and the loading of the filter element.
Pressure drop curves in seal gas coalescing application show three stages:
1.
Start-up (clean) pressure-drop
When a new filter element is installed, the element is clean and dry, the filter media pores are not blocked with particles or liquid droplets, and gas flows freely; most of the pressure-drop is caused by the filter system.
The start-up pressure-drop (clean and dry filter element) of the total system is described in the API 692 as filter sizing parameter.
2.
Operational (saturated) pressure-drop
The filter element is capturing/**coalescing** and draining liquids from the gas flow.
The filter element pores are partially blocked with captured droplets (saturated) and the gas has more restrictions when passing through.
The operational pressure-drop when fully saturated can be 4 times higher than start-up.

Фильтры-коалесцеры широко применяются в установках систем очистки природного, транспортируемого, попутного нефтяного газов, в установках систем очистки топливного, импульсного и буферного газов, а также в установках систем очистки сжатого воздуха и других технических газов.

Фильтры-коалесцеры предназначены для тонкой очистки жидких и газообразных сред от механических частиц и капельной жидкости. В корпус фильтра-коалесцера устанавливаются нерегенерируемые, сменные фильтрующие элементы (картриджи) коалесцирующего типа.

В фильтрах-коалесцерах очистка среды от жидких примесей происходит благодаря способности фильтрующего элемента коалесцировать (объединять) жидкие аэрозольные частички мельчайшего диаметра от 0,3 мкм в более крупные с последующим накоплением и удалением жидкости через дренажную систему фильтра.
